MySQL:如何通过日志来定位和解决问题
在MySQL中,日志是诊断问题和定位错误的重要工具。以下是如何通过日志来解决问题的步骤:
查看系统日志:
在Linux或MacOS上,你通常可以通过logrotate
命令查看MySQL的日志文件。例如,你可以检查/var/log/mysql.log
。理解日志格式:
MySQL的错误和警告信息通常包含时间戳、事件类型、详细描述等字段。熟悉这些内容有助于快速定位问题。搜索特定错误或警告:
当你知道问题可能出在哪里时,可以在日志中搜索相应的关键词。例如,如果错误消息提到了“table_not_found”这个错误号,你就可以在日志里找到相关的条目。分析日志前后的情况:
通过查看日志的完整内容,你可以了解问题发生前后的状态变化。这有助于确定问题的根本原因。
总之,通过深入理解和利用MySQL的日志,你可以更有效地定位和解决问题。
还没有评论,来说两句吧...